加入收藏 | 设为首页 | 会员中心 | 我要投稿 91站长网 (https://www.91zhanzhang.com/)- 机器学习、操作系统、大数据、低代码、数据湖!
当前位置: 首页 > 站长学院 > Asp教程 > 正文

ASP进阶:高效对象组件编程实战

发布时间:2025-09-25 12:00:56 所属栏目:Asp教程 来源:DaWei
导读: 在大数据开发的实践中,ASP(Active Server Pages)虽然已经逐渐被更现代的技术所取代,但其核心理念——对象组件编程(OOP)——仍然是构建高效、可维护系统的基础。 对象组件编程的核心在于封装、继承和多态

在大数据开发的实践中,ASP(Active Server Pages)虽然已经逐渐被更现代的技术所取代,但其核心理念——对象组件编程(OOP)——仍然是构建高效、可维护系统的基础。


对象组件编程的核心在于封装、继承和多态。在ASP中,通过使用VBScript或JScript实现的类和对象,可以将业务逻辑与界面分离,提升代码的复用性和可扩展性。


在实际项目中,合理设计组件结构是关键。例如,可以将数据访问层、业务逻辑层和表现层分别封装为独立的组件,这样不仅便于调试,也方便后期维护和升级。


使用全局变量或Session来传递对象实例可能会导致状态混乱,因此建议采用依赖注入或工厂模式来管理对象生命周期,确保系统的稳定性和可测试性。


AI模拟效果图,仅供参考

在处理大规模数据时,ASP组件的性能优化尤为重要。避免在组件中进行过多的数据库查询或复杂的计算,应尽量将这些操作转移到后端服务或缓存机制中。


通过引入面向对象的设计思想,可以显著提高ASP应用的模块化程度。每个组件应专注于单一职责,这样不仅降低了耦合度,也提高了代码的清晰度。


对于团队协作而言,统一的组件命名规范和接口定义能够减少沟通成本,使不同开发者能够快速理解并集成彼此的代码。


尽管ASP技术已不再是主流,但其中蕴含的对象组件编程思想依然值得深入研究和实践,尤其是在构建复杂系统时,良好的架构设计是成功的关键。

(编辑:91站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章